Slavisa Tomic. Concluiu o Doutoramento em Engenharia Electrotécnica e de Computadores em 2017 pela Universidade Nova de Lisboa Faculdade de Ciências e Tecnologia. Publicou mais de 35 artigos em revistas internacionais Q1/Q2 especializadas na área de Tecnologias de Informação e Comunicação, sub-área Redes e Telecomunicações e 1 livro. De acordo com a métodologia desenvolvida pela Universidade Stanford em 2020, entre 2019 e 2022 figurava entre os investigadores mais influentes do mundo ao integrar o top de 2% de cientistas cujo trabalho é mais citado por outros colegas na área de Tecnologias de Informação e Comunicação, sub-área Redes e Telecomunicações. É Professor Associado da Universidade Lusófona, Centro Universitário Lisboa (UL-CUL), e investigador sénior do COPELABS (CTS).
